Marble and porcelain are very different materials. Marble is a natural stone, meaning that no two pieces will be the same. Porcelain is a manufactured material that can replicate the look but will never have the shade variation of the real thing. Porcelain is easier to maintain, but marble gives you that timeless look and feel. Choosing between porcelain and marble is all about what fits the needs of your space.
